Supercondensers

Supercondensers, or supercapacitators, are electrophysical energy accumulators that have been long considered one of the most interesting options for electric or partially electric drive cars. Unlike conventional electro-chemical batteries, they have higher performance (they charge and discharge energy much more quickly) but, on the other hand, their capacity is lower (they store less energy though being the same size).

The simplest supercapacitator is composed of two electrodes, a separator and an electrolyte: the electric field is captured at the interface between the electrodes and the electrolyte.

The ones that are most researched on and best sold use electrolytes in water or organic solutions as well as carbon electrodes with a high superficial area. In order to increase the superficial area of the electrodes, most advanced research laboratories worldwide are developing carbon nanotube materials, or electrodes composed of a nano carbon film.

Unlike electrochemical batteries, double layer condensers do not virtually wear out: standing over 500,000 charging and discharging operations they have got a life of at least more than 10 years, without impairing the capacity which does not change at all depending on the time and number of operations carried out.

Their capacity of being charged and discharged using high voltage currents is really outstanding and that is very important for “regenerative brakes” as well as when charging and discharging operations have to be done very quickly. In regenerative braking the kinetic energy is converted into electric power to be stored and released very quickly for the following acceleration. In urban areas where braking and accelerating are typical features of driving cycles, they might even help save energy by up to 25%.
